Police parade suspected cultists in Kwara

Kwara State police command has paraded four suspected cultists and one robber in Ilorin, the state capital.

The suspected cultists were said to be members of Eiye confraternity.

The state  Commissioner of Police, Sam Okaula, paraded the suspects shortly after receiving Toyota Hilux van, donated to the command by the proprietor of Solid Worth Hotels, Ilorin.

Okaula said the police recovered from the four suspected cultists, two cut-to-size double barrel guns and one long single barrel gun.

He stated that acting on intelligence, the Anti-vice operatives, stormed the rendezvous of the suspected cultists in Oyun area of Ilorin ,while they were preparing to go out for operation.

"They are notorious members of Eiye confranternity. They are confessed cultists. With these weapons, you can imagine the atrocities they have committed. One of them has been recruiting cult members in Ilorin metropolis. He has confessed and mentioned a lot of names and I can assure you that the command is after these suspects. We smoked them out of their hideouts and we have clearly told them that they either relocate from their hideouts and we have our harmony and peace or they meet with their waterloo."

"This appears to be the end of the atrocities they have been committing over the time. We will thoroughly investigate them and prosecute them accordingly. I can assure members of the public that this war is ongoing and we need information from members of the public. We need their cooperation and collaboration and we would ensure that peace continues in Kwara State.

"Some of them claimed to be students and some of them have graduated according to them. But we are in the process of confirming whether they are students or they have graduated", he said.
